#include <cmath>
#include "Color.h"
#include "Exceptions.h"
using namespace openshot;
// Constructor which takes R,G,B,A
Color::Color(unsigned char Red, unsigned char Green, unsigned char Blue, unsigned char Alpha) :
red(static_cast<double>(Red)),
green(static_cast<double>(Green)),
blue(static_cast<double>(Blue)),
alpha(static_cast<double>(Alpha)) { }
// Constructor which takes 4 existing Keyframe curves
Color::Color(Keyframe Red, Keyframe Green, Keyframe Blue, Keyframe Alpha) :
red(Red), green(Green), blue(Blue), alpha(Alpha) { }
// Constructor which takes a QColor
Color::Color(QColor qcolor) :
red(qcolor.red()),
green(qcolor.green()),
blue(qcolor.blue()),
alpha(qcolor.alpha()) { }
// Constructor which takes a HEX color code
Color::Color(std::string color_hex)
: Color::Color(QString::fromStdString(color_hex)) {}
Color::Color(const char* color_hex)
: Color::Color(QString(color_hex)) {}
// Get the HEX value of a color at a specific frame
std::string Color::GetColorHex(int64_t frame_number) {
int r = red.GetInt(frame_number);
int g = green.GetInt(frame_number);
int b = blue.GetInt(frame_number);
int a = alpha.GetInt(frame_number);
return QColor( r,g,b,a ).name().toStdString();
}
// Get RGBA values for a specific frame as an integer vector
std::vector<int> Color::GetColorRGBA(int64_t frame_number) {
std::vector<int> rgba;
rgba.push_back(red.GetInt(frame_number));
rgba.push_back(green.GetInt(frame_number));
rgba.push_back(blue.GetInt(frame_number));
rgba.push_back(alpha.GetInt(frame_number));
return rgba;
}
// Get the distance between 2 RGB pairs (alpha is ignored)
long Color::GetDistance(long R1, long G1, long B1, long R2, long G2, long B2)
{
long rmean = ( R1 + R2 ) / 2;
long r = R1 - R2;
long g = G1 - G2;
long b = B1 - B2;
return sqrt((((512+rmean)*r*r)>>8) + 4*g*g + (((767-rmean)*b*b)>>8));
}
// Generate JSON string of this object
std::string Color::Json() const {
// Return formatted string
return JsonValue().toStyledString();
}
// Generate Json::Value for this object
Json::Value Color::JsonValue() const {
// Create root json object
Json::Value root;
root["red"] = red.JsonValue();
root["green"] = green.JsonValue();
root["blue"] = blue.JsonValue();
root["alpha"] = alpha.JsonValue();
// return JsonValue
return root;
}
// Load JSON string into this object
void Color::SetJson(const std::string value) {
// Parse JSON string into JSON objects
try
{
const Json::Value root = openshot::stringToJson(value);
// Set all values that match
SetJsonValue(root);
}
catch (const std::exception& e)
{
// Error parsing JSON (or missing keys)
throw InvalidJSON("JSON is invalid (missing keys or invalid data types)");
}
}
// Load Json::Value into this object
void Color::SetJsonValue(const Json::Value root) {
// Set data from Json (if key is found)
if (!root["red"].isNull())
red.SetJsonValue(root["red"]);
if (!root["green"].isNull())
green.SetJsonValue(root["green"]);
if (!root["blue"].isNull())
blue.SetJsonValue(root["blue"]);
if (!root["alpha"].isNull())
alpha.SetJsonValue(root["alpha"]);
}
